The City of Whitehouse Police Department has been awarded a federal grant of $23,955.94 through the Edward Byrne Memorial Justice Assistance Grant (JAG) Program, administered by the Office of the Governor. This funding, made possible by the U.S. Department of Justice, will provide the Whitehouse Police Department with essential resources to enhance patrol unit capabilities. […]
DPS Launches Statewide Patrols to Enforce Seat belt Use and Curb Distracted Driving for Memorial Day
AUSTIN – The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S) is increasing patrols statewide as part of its annual All-American enforcement campaign ahead of the Memorial Day Holiday. From May 12 through May 26, the Texas Highway Patrol (THP) will focus on enforcing seat belt laws and promoting safe driving behaviors to reduce crashes and save lives. […]

Staff Reports WACO, Texas – NFL superstar Patrick Mahomes, a Whitehouse High School graduate, was officially inducted into the Texas High School Football Hall of Fame this month, recognizing his exceptional athletic career and lasting impact on Texas high school football. Mahomes, a 2014 graduate of Whitehouse High School, was a multi-sport athlete who made […]
Bullard, TX—Today, Bullard ISD recognized 14 teachers for earning Teacher Incentive Allotment (TIA) designations awarded by the Texas Education Agency. These fourteen teachers earned a TEA designation for the first time or moved up to a designation level higher than they earned last year. Funded in House Bill 3 (HB 3) by the 86th Texas […]
